Transaction e077407e6cfb5bbd348924052c46b5b95938d34d782dc04e15035c343385c462

1 Input
2 Outputs
  • e077407e6cfb5bbd348924052c46b5b95938d34d782dc04e15035c343385c462:0
  • value  7008757
    address  121kc6vttBepFt8ubcTMzYdyu1FkUH7R6v
  • e077407e6cfb5bbd348924052c46b5b95938d34d782dc04e15035c343385c462:1
  • value  16479437
    address  1L2aoa4JQr47uy7pAAyaskqEuJfiYKbTuw